3 Game Blood Bowl 2020 Swiss style resurrection tournament (your team roster gets reset and none of the injuries carry over onto the next round. In essence your players are all "Resurrected")

Team Building

Each team receives the gold and SP based on the below tiering.

Cash given is also used to buy rerolls, assistant coaches, cheerleaders, apothecary
and so on.

Undead, Necromantic and Nurgle teams are allowed to apply the Masters of
Undeath and Plague Ridden special rules. Players added to a team roster through a
game as a result of those special rules are removed from the roster at the end of that
game.

Teams will consist of a minimum of 11 players and a maximum of 16 players, including star players.


Tiers
Tier1: Amazons, Dark Elves, Dwarves, Lizardmen, Shambling Undead, Underworld Denizens, Skaven.
Tier2: Chaos Dwarves, Norse, Orcs, Wood Elves, Vampires.
Tier3: Elven Union, High Elves, Humans, Necromantic Horror, Tomb Kings.
Tier4: Chaos Renegades, Khorne, Old World Alliance, Slann.
Tier5: Black Orcs, Chaos Chosen, Imperial Nobility, Snotlings.
Tier6: Goblins, Halflings, Nurgle, Ogres.


Starting Gold and Skill Points (SP)
Tier 1: 1150k & 06 SP (1 secondary max)
Tier 2: 1160k & 07 SP (1 secondary max)
Tier 3: 1170k & 08 SP (2 secondary max)
Tier 4: 1180k & 09 SP (3 secondary max)
Tier 5: 1190k & 10 SP (3 secondary max)
Tier 6: 1200k & 11 SP (unlimited secondary)

Primary Skill = 1 SP
Secondary Skill = 2 SP

Tier 1 and 2: Can’t stack skills.
Tier 3 and 4: Can stack 2 primary skills onto one player.
Tier 5 and 6: Can stack 2 primary skills onto two different players.

0-8 Re-Rolls, cost depending on race.
0-6 Assistant coaches for 10k.
0-12 Cheerleaders for 10k.
0-1 Apothecary, depending on race.
1-6 Dedicated fans for 10k, be aware that every team begins with 0 in Dedicated fans.
Inducements

0-1 Team Mascot for 30k available to all teams.
0-1 Weather Mage for 30k available to all teams.
0-2 Bloodweiser Kegs each for 50k available to all teams.
0-3 Bribes for 100k each, for "Bribery and Corruption" teams 50k each.
0-1 Josef Bugman for 100k available to all teams.
0-1 Mortuary Assistant for 100k available to teams with the "Sylvanian Spotlight" special rule.
0-1 Plague Doctor for 100k available to teams with the "Favored of Nurgle" special rule.
0-1 Riotous Rookies for 100k available to teams with the "Low Cost Linemen" special rule.
0-2 Wandering Apothecaries for 100k available to teams that can include an apothecary.
0-1 Biased Referee for 120k available to all teams, 80k for teams with the Bribery & Corruption special rule.
0-1 Master Chef for 300k, for 100k available to teams with the "Halfling Thimble Cup" special rule.

A roster cannot induce bribes if there is a player with the Sneaky Git skill AND/OR the Secret
Weapon skill.

Goblin, Orges, Black Orcs and Snotlings teams have managed to find a "legal" way to avoid this rule, so they can induce bribes while their roster contains players with the Secret Weapon skill AND/OR the Sneaky Git skill.


Star Players

Star players can only be induced after 11 regular players have already been rostered.

Star players can’t be given extra skills from the team’s skill budget.

One (1) Star Player can be rostered for Tier 1-4 teams, up to two (2) Star Players can be rostered for Tier 5-6 teams.
Star Players that must be hired as a pair (Dribl & Drull, Grak & Crumbleberry, etc) count as one Star Players.

Star Players cost Skill Points as follows:
Less than 100k cost 0 Skill Point
100k up to 199k cost 1 Skill Points
200 up to 299k cost 2 Skill Points

Banned Star Players: Griff Oberwald, Hakflem Skuttlespike, Morg 'n' Thorg, Bomber Dribblesnot, Cindy Piewhistle, Deeproot Strongbranch, Kreek Rustgouger, Estelle La Veneaux and Skitter Stab-Stab.

The same Star Player cannot play in a game where both coaches have rostered them.

TOURNAMENT SCORING
At the start of each Round you will receive 1x Match Result form per Pitch. Please complete these during the Match and hand them in after you have finished.

• Per Win: +30 Points
• Per Draw: +10 Points
• Per Loss: +0 Points
• Per TD: +1 Points (max 5 per Match)
• Per CAS: +1 Points (max 5 per Match)
• Shutout: +3 Points (No TDs Allowed)

CASUALTIES
All Casualties caused to your opponent's team during YOUR turn count – this includes Blocks, Fouls, Crowd Surfing, Secret Weapons, being hit by thrown players, etc.


Individual Tie breakers…
1. Opponent score
2. Net TDs
3. Net Cas
4. Best of three – rock paper scissors
